Human imaging scientific tests have shown CBD impacts Mind parts linked to the neurobiology of psychiatric Conditions. A research has showed that just one dose of CBD, administered orally in healthier volunteers, alters the resting exercise in limbic and paralimbic Mind spots even though decreasing subjective stress and anxiety associated with the scanning technique.[24,39] CBD decreased the exercise of the left amygdala–hippocampal sophisticated, hypothalamus, and posterior cingulated cortex even though rising the exercise in the remaining parahippocampal gyrus as opposed with placebo.

Endogenously, endocannabinoids serve as neuro-regulatory modulators responsible for retrograde neurotransmission. A publish-synaptic neuron releases endocannabinoids that bind to predominantly CB1 receptors on the presynaptic neuron. This binding results in inhibited presynaptic calcium channel activation and subsequent presynaptic neurotransmitter release.

THC is the only plant cannabinoid that you understand of course has distinct intoxicating effects By itself. There is certainly some evidence to advise that THCV may well also have intoxicating effects, Though irrespective of next page whether it does may perhaps depend on dose.
To create matters a lot more sophisticated, cannabinoids’ effects can be affected by other cannabinoids, terpenes or flavonoids current from the cannabis staying eaten. This therapeutic synergy is referred to as the ‘entourage effect,’ which is an acknowledgment that cannabis’ Energetic substances seem to be to operate alongside one another to build effects that wouldn’t come from any of their sections individually. The interaction of CBD with CB2 receptors is a lot more complicated, but like Δ9-THC, CBD is believed to reduce the inflammatory response. CBD's action Together with the CB2 receptor is only one of quite a few pathways by which CBD can have an effect on neuroinflammation [Table 2]. Due to the fact the two CBD and Δ9-THC modulate the activity of G protein-coupled receptors linked to the endocannabinoid process, and CBD can functionality to be a partial agonist and antagonizes Δnine-THC, CBD at increased doses may possibly counter to some extent the psychoactive effects of Δnine-THC.[77] Anecdotally, this effect is famous by many cannabis people who co-ingest CBD.
